KCZ 5888 is a 2008 Lexus LS600H in Red with a 4,969cc other eng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2008 Lexus LS600H models, the average MOT pass rate is 88.4% with a typical mileage of 82,450 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Lexus LS600H fails its MOT is tyre has ply or cords exposed, accounting for 91 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KCZ 5888,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Lexus LS600H typ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 18 years old, this Lexus LS600H is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
